The Senate of the National University of Ireland recently approved the proposal to remove the third language requirement for Maynooth University's Business, Accounting, Finance and Law degree programmes.
With effect from today, for entry 2017 and subsequently, a third language is not required for any of the MH400 and MH500 degrees; namely MH401, MH403, MH404, MH405, MH407, MH411 as well as MH501 and MH502.
Applicants for any of the above degrees, who are not presenting a third language, may add one or more of the above courses to their CAO list before February 1st, 2017 or in the change of mind period between May 5th and July 1st, 2017.
